Cynthia (Cindy) Gunnells Foshee of Columbia, SC, 63, passed away on July 24, 2025.

Born to Robert E. Gunnells, Sr. and Martha R. Gunnells, she is survived by her husband of 43 years, David Foshee of Columbia, SC; father, Robert E. Gunnells Sr. of Greenwood, SC; and daughter Kadie Austen (Brien Hollingsworth) of Greenville, SC.

She was predeceased by her mother, Martha, stepmother, Joyce Scott Gunnells, and brother, Robert "Bob" E. Gunnells Jr.

Cindy was a loving mother and wife. Cindy loved floating in her pool in the summer, catching up with long-time friends every Friday night over dinner, and taking care of her family and friends. Most of all, she loved her little pup, Maddie.

We owe a special thanks to Cathy Lipscomb of Greenville, SC, for the selfless gift of life. In 2005, Cathy donated her kidney to Cindy, allowing Cindy to continue being an amazing wife and mother for 20 additional years. Cathy was only a professional acquaintance when she heard Cindy's Story about her lifelong struggle with kidney disease. Without hesitation, she wanted to give Cindy the gift of life. At that moment, she became part of our family.

A Celebration of Life will be held at 11:00 AM on Saturday, August 2, 2025, at Ninety Six Pentecostal Holiness Church, 206 State Street, Ninety Six, SC 29666.

In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to PETSinc, 300 Orchard Drive, West Columbia, SC 29170, or the National Kidney Foundation at kidney.org.

Kornegay Funeral Home, Lugoff-Elgin Chapel, is in charge of arrangements.
